Bill overview
This bill, the POWER Act, temporarily suspends matching fund requirements and related reporting for federal grants aimed at preventing family violence and providing services. It allows states to receive these grants without having to match funds themselves, specifically for fiscal years 2019 and 2020, and continues this waiver during the ongoing COVID-19 public health emergency. The goal is to increase the availability of resources for domestic violence victims and survivors.
